      Eastern United VS Adelaide Olympic Eastern United favors a 4-2-3-1 formation at home, focusing on low-block defensive counterattacks. In the midfield, they mainly rely on interceptions. Once they regain the ball, they quickly launch long passes to find the fast strikers. Their wing attacks are direct and efficient, and they are good at seizing the space behind the opponents when they push forward. Recently, Eastern United's home form has been inconsistent. Their defense can easily lose concentration, and they are weak in defending high balls. They struggle under continuous pressure. On the offensive end, they rely on quick transitions and set-pieces. They have limited options in positional play, with a relatively low possession rate but decent counterattack efficiency. Their overall playing style is practical and direct, centered around solid defense and surprise attacks.     • Brazil VS Morocco Brazil typically deploys a 4-3-3 formation, aiming to intercept the opponents' through passes in the midfield. Vinícius and Raniyah are positioned on the left and right wings respectively. They rely on their dribbling skills to stretch the opponents' defense, then cut inside to shoot or cross the ball to create scoring opportunities for the center-forward. Paquetá moves around the flanks, delivering precise through passes to break through the opponents' compact defense. The full-backs push forward moderately to widen the attacking width. Once the ball is lost, they quickly initiate a high press to force the opponents into making hasty passing mistakes. During set - pieces, the center - backs use their headers to expand scoring options. However, the team has some weaknesses. When the full - backs push forward, there are large gaps left behind them.     • Haiti VS Scotland Haiti typically employs a 4-4-2 formation and switches to a 5-4-1 compact defensive structure when under pressure on the pitch. The team boasts excellent physical fitness. Instead of insisting on ball possession, they focus on creating a midfield interception zone to restrict the opponent's passing and advancement. The team's transition from defense to attack is straightforward. After winning the ball in the back - field, they use long passes to bypass the midfield. The two forwards rely on their power to break through behind the opponents' defenders. The wingers provide timely support with cross - passes to assist the central players in scoring. They also try to win headers from set - pieces in the attacking third. However, the team has obvious weaknesses. Their small - scale passing and cooperation on the ground lack coordination.     • Australia VS Turkey Australia typically deploys a 3-4-2-1 formation, switching to a 5-4-1 compact setup in the defensive phase. The team adheres to a pragmatic power - football style, willingly ceding midfield ball - possession. They rely on the whole team's contraction to build multiple defensive barriers. The double defensive midfielders spread horizontally to block through - passes, while the three central defenders stand closely to control the airspace in the penalty area, using physical confrontation to disrupt the opponents' dribbling. When transitioning from defense to attack, the team's rhythm is simple and direct. After a steal in the back - field, they send long passes to the flanks. The speedy wingers then sprint along the touchline to exploit the gaps in the opponents' defense.
